		<description><![CDATA[Phillipe ended up turning to IBM support for help. Here&#039;s what they said:

In a remote outq (with an IP Adress), for printers like HP* for exemple, you must change the parameter with value &#039;XAIX&#039; (in big caracters), like
that:

Options de destination . . . . .DESTOPT(&#039;XAIX&#039;)
